Transaction ec83dcfe14a59c1087b4bbffe5e03c2152dc25b394260270a87cf26cdb42b3a1
1 Input
1 Output
-
ec83dcfe14a59c1087b4bbffe5e03c2152dc25b394260270a87cf26cdb42b3a1:0
- value
- 14952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a0e2f7ac37177aef4985f73803f3e9a15b048a5 OP_EQUAL
- address
- 36yz7HyPohAVTNrfmMVatm5RqJyEQnNbG2